What will your essential responsibilities include?
- Conducts performance evaluations; recommends salary adjustments; coaches and counsels staff.
- Establishes unit and individual goals in concert with the Operations Lead.
- Ensures compliance with predetermined work flows and procedures.
- Ensures compliance of the unit with Internal Audit, Peer Reviews and or Framework for Internal Control audit recommendations. Assists with developing appropriate responses and action plans in response to internal and external audit findings.
- Ensures work is completed in accordance with service standards.
- Review and manage production and quality control reports and take appropriate action (eg data quality, reinsurance, production status control reports).
- Translates Quality, Timeliness, Productivity and Service Delivery requirements into individual, team, and unit performance goals, recommends how and when performance measurements will be done and how to collect performance data.
- Keeps Department Management informed of status and progress in the unit.
- Actively manages the team in all aspects, such as hiring, performance management, development and trainings, schedule coordination etc.
- Maintains open communication with the underwriters that the unit supports in order to foster partnership and teamwork.
